Compatibility with Gaming Platforms

The first step is to determine the compatibility of Beats earbuds with your preferred gaming platform. While Beats earbuds are primarily designed for use with Apple devices, they can also be paired with Android smartphones, PCs, and gaming consoles. However, certain features may be limited or unavailable on non-Apple devices.

Audio Quality and Latency

Audio quality is paramount for an immersive gaming experience. Beats earbuds generally offer excellent sound reproduction with rich bass and clear highs. However, latency, the delay between audio and visual cues, can be an issue. While Beats earbuds have improved latency over previous models, they may not be ideal for competitive or fast-paced games.

Microphone Performance

Communication is key in multiplayer games. The microphone quality of Beats earbuds is decent for casual use but may not be suitable for serious gaming. Background noise suppression and clarity can be limited, affecting your ability to communicate effectively with teammates.

Comfort and Fit

Gaming sessions can last for hours, so comfort is crucial. Beats earbuds come with various ear tip sizes to ensure a secure and comfortable fit. However, their in-ear design may not be suitable for all users, especially those with sensitive ears.

Battery Life

Battery life is another important consideration. Beats earbuds typically offer up to 8 hours of listening time on a single charge. This may be sufficient for casual gaming sessions, but prolonged use may require recharging or using a charging case.

Alternative Options for Gaming

If Beats earbuds do not meet your specific gaming needs, there are several alternative options available:

  • Dedicated Gaming Headsets: These headsets are specifically designed for gaming, offering low latency, high-quality audio, and comfortable wear for extended periods.
  • Wireless Earbuds with Low Latency: Certain wireless earbuds, such as the Razer Hammerhead True Wireless Pro or the JBL Quantum TWS, are designed with low latency specifically for gaming.
  • Wired Earbuds: Wired earbuds offer the lowest latency and the most stable connection, making them ideal for competitive gaming.

Common Questions and Answers

Q: Can I use any Beats earbuds for gaming?
A: While all Beats earbuds can be paired with gaming platforms, some models may offer better latency or microphone performance specifically designed for gaming.

Q: Will Beats earbuds work with my gaming console?
A: Yes, Beats earbuds can be paired with gaming consoles such as Xbox and PlayStation via Bluetooth or an audio jack adapter.

Q: How can I minimize latency with Beats earbuds?
A: Enable the “Low Latency Mode” feature in the Beats app (if available) to reduce latency. Additionally, ensure a strong and stable Bluetooth connection.

Q: Can I use Beats earbuds for voice chat on gaming platforms?
A: Yes, Beats earbuds with a built-in microphone can be used for voice chat on gaming platforms, but the microphone quality may vary.

Q: How long do Beats earbuds last on a single charge while gaming?
A: Battery life varies depending on the model and usage, but generally ranges from 4-8 hours on a single charge.
